Family Secrets 1: Empty Plate is a short horror game focused on a family situation inside one home. The story follows Miko, who receives a call from his mother and learns that she has to leave for work for several days. Because of this, Miko becomes responsible for looking after his younger sibling, Jun. The game uses this setup to build a short narrative about being left alone, taking care of the house, and facing events that begin to feel unsafe.
The game has a clear story, but it is not a large adventure with many chapters or separate routes. The main setting is the house, and the player moves through it while following the events around Miko and Jun. The situation begins in a normal way, but the tone changes as the player continues. The game does not ask the user to create a character, choose a class, or make major story decisions. It is a prepared horror experience with a fixed direction.
Family Secrets 1: Empty Plate does not have traditional levels. The game is closer to a short playable story where progress comes from exploring rooms, checking objects, and triggering the next event. The official page lists the playtime at about 30–40 minutes, so the structure is compact rather than long.

The gameplay is based on movement, observation, and interaction. There is no combat system, weapon collection, upgrade tree, or score-based progression. The player uses basic controls to explore the home and continue the story. The flashlight is important because it helps the player see darker spaces and notice details. The game’s tension comes from the setting, the family situation, and the events that happen while the mother is away.
To play Family Secrets 1: Empty Plate, the user starts the Windows version and controls the character through the house. The player should move carefully, interact with available objects, read or follow dialogue, and use the flashlight when needed. The goal is not to clear many stages or complete side quests. The main objective is to reach the end of the short horror story and learn how the situation with Miko and Jun develops.
